/// Enable logging with the specified level
/// Enable logging with the specified level.
///
/// This function initializes a `tracing` subscriber with the given log level.
/// If the `RUST_LOG` environment variable is set, its directives take
/// precedence (useful for ad-hoc debugging); otherwise per-crate filter
/// directives derived from `level` are used. The env var is only *read*,
/// never written, so the call is safe from any thread context (including
/// after a Tokio runtime has started).
///
/// The subscriber's built-in `tracing-log` bridge captures output from
/// crates that use the `log` facade, so a separate `env_logger::init()`
/// is not required.
///
/// If a global subscriber has already been set (e.g., by a previous call),
/// subsequent calls are a no-op and the original level is retained.
///
/// Level values: 0 = Error, 1 = Warn, 2 = Info, 3 = Debug, 4 = Trace
#[no_mangle]
pub extern "C" fn dash_sdk_enable_logging(level: u8) {
use std::env;

let log_level = match level {
0 => "error",
1 => "warn",

#[cfg(test)]
mod tests {
use super::*;

/// Verify that `dash_sdk_enable_logging` does NOT set the RUST_LOG
/// environment variable. This is the core property that makes the
/// function safe to call from a multi-threaded context.
#[test]
fn enable_logging_does_not_set_env_var() {
// If RUST_LOG is already set by the test harness or environment,
// we cannot reliably detect whether our function sets it, so skip.
if std::env::var_os("RUST_LOG").is_some() {
return;
}

// Call the function under test with each supported level.
for level in 0..=4 {
dash_sdk_enable_logging(level);
}

// The function must NOT have set RUST_LOG.
assert!(
std::env::var("RUST_LOG").is_err(),
"RUST_LOG should not be set by dash_sdk_enable_logging; \
env::set_var must not be used because it is a data race \
in multi-threaded programs"
);
}

/// Verify that the function can be called from multiple threads
/// concurrently without panicking (i.e., no data race).
#[test]
fn enable_logging_is_thread_safe() {
let handles: Vec<_> = (0..4)
.map(|i| {
std::thread::spawn(move || {
dash_sdk_enable_logging(i % 5);
})
})
.collect();

for h in handles {
h.join().expect("thread should not panic");
}
}
}
